Police say DNA report of vaginal swab of Bhagarathi matches with arrested teenager



KATHMANDU: The DNA report of vaginal swab of Baitadi’s Bhagarathi Bhatta has matched with that of the accused.

Bhagarathi was murdered after rape on February 3 when she was returning home from school.

She had gone missing while on the way back from Sanatan Dharma Secondary School, police said.

According to the Spokesperson at the Far West Police Office SSP Mukesh Kumar Singh, the report from the National Forensic Science Laboratory has showed that the DNA of vaginal swab matched with that of the teenager, who is currently at a correctional facility in Dipayal.

The police had made the accused public on February 17 organizing a press conference.

While Bhagarathi was a 12th grader, the accused is an 11th-grader studying at the same school.

Bhagarathi’s body was found in a forest.

The youth had told the police that he had raped and murdered Bhagarathi to take revenge.
